Given the quality and reliability demands for complex PCBs, manufacturing processes are qualified; that is, the PCB design, must meet the long-term reliability requirements demanded and quality standards desired. As a result, cleaning is becoming a mandatory step within the manufacturing process.
Analytical tests are key elements to any qualification process. In particular, IPC-TM-650, method 2.6.3.7 or SIR (Surface Insulation Resistance) is frequently used regardless of the solder paste/flux type. Per the specification, this test can quantify the deleterious effects of fabrication, process or handling residues on SIR in the presence of moisture. Measuring changes in surface resistance is a standard way of testing cleanliness and long-term reliability of a test board or complete process assembly based on industry standards.
This study was designed to compare different SIR test vehicles, from a cleaning perspective, in order to determine which test vehicle is tougher to clean and therefore challenge the cleaning process. Cleanliness verification and validation was completed by visual inspection underneath all components as well as by performing SIR tests. For more information, please visit IPC APEX.
